FutureLearn, the OU UK’s entrant into the MOOCosphere is now live. Here’s the “About” text from the site:
About FutureLearn
FutureLearn will offer online courses from many of the best Universities in the UK for free, enabling everyone, everywhere to enjoy learning throughout their lives. Our aim is to increase access to higher education for people around the world by offering a diverse range of high quality courses and content from great Universities, educators and institutions across multiple platforms. Partnering with the British Library, the British Council, the British Museum and 20 of the UK’s top universities, our first courses will be launched later this year.FutureLearn is a private company owned by the Open University. We are building on the OU’s unparalleled expertise in delivering distance and open learning to hundreds of thousands of people and combining this with online and mobile technology and the best of the social web to reinvent the learning experience. We hope to inspire people to continue to learn throughout their lives.
